[Opinions] A few Welsh BAs
Begw Elain (parents Rhodri and Catrin) *
Elen (parents Nia Cerys and Dafydd, brother Owain)
Lisa Catrin (parents Llinos and Stu)
Osian Dafydd Myrddin (parents Dafydd and Sian)
Dyfan Lewis (parents Gareth and Lindsay)* = Begw is a short form of Marged, like Peggy for Margaret. Looks like the nicknames-as-full-names trend is getting popular in Wales too. Elain is pr. EL-ine, to rhyme with mine, and means 'fawn' - it's not related to Elaine.

W-nicknames have always been around, but it's only recently that I've started to see them as full names on babies - a couple of Nanws, a Nedw (nn for Edward), a Nelw (nn for Elin). They do seem a bit cutesy to me, but also nicer than the -ie English nns, although I'm probably biased.
